(F-) ara thi ∆(lac-proAB) rpsL Φ80dlacZ∆M15
1994, J. Messing, Rutgers State Univ., Piscataway, NJ, USA: strain JM83
Strain JM83 (K-12 derivative), widely used as a host strain for pUC cloning purposes, enabling blue/white colony screening in the absence of isopropyl-ß-thiogalactoside (IPTG) inducer
Streptomycin resistant
